The IR1 visa is granted to spouses of United States citizens, conferring the holder permanent resident status. This status, also known as the ”Green Card”, gives you the right to live and work in any state in the country without geographic restrictions.
In other words, once the IR1 visa is approved, you are not limited to a specific region – your new home can be anywhere in the United States, and the freedom to seek job opportunities extends throughout the territory.
Furthermore, unrestricted access to the labor market is one of the advantages of being a permanent resident. You will have the opportunity to build your career and explore diverse opportunities regardless of location.
